May 2008 Meeting – Insulation AND Energy Audit Results
INSULATION
The topic of Insulation was covered by two presenters:
Bill Pemberton, of Scarab solutions, gave a comprehensive overview of the reasons for insulating and covered a range of insulation products.
Jason Bond, from The Environment Shop, brought along samples of the products and discussed their application and use.
Interesting aspects of the night were:
1. The negative comments on modern refrigerators (one of the great energy users)
2. The strong recommendation to go for R3.5 in a ceiling
3. The discussion on the benefits of “insulating paint” ie the ones containing ceramic beads
4. The recommendation for Rock Wool where sound insulation is a consideration (ie teenagers bedrooms!!)
5. The use of Air Cell
